In KDE3 konsole I can have a bookmark with the address "ssh -X -C -t -p 45637 
user@xxxxxxxxxxx". Basically I can save any command from the command line as a 
bookmark. With KDE4 the bookmarks seems to be limited to ssh:// URLs. Thats 
the problem. I have to setup a connection in ~/ssh/ssh_config. Normally I 
connect in different ways with ssh to a host. Setting up host specific 
parameters in ssh_config would limit any ssh connection to the host to the 
configuration I made in ssh_config. Therefore I normally don't use it.
